Output 51d4bab54fcb982f12e2a74b061ba73dd4aedc0dd619f6354106997604e8b015:25

value
785
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76630626668378e35bd16627d5eb5d7b291deab8eff5ae70af4ae185bb3c50cc
address
bc1pwe3svfnxsduwxk73vcnat66a0v53m64cal66uu90ftsctweu2rxq869uy8
transaction
51d4bab54fcb982f12e2a74b061ba73dd4aedc0dd619f6354106997604e8b015